商家入驻
发布需求

专门APP软件开发定制软件有哪些

   2025-06-25 9
导读

随着科技的不断发展,移动应用已成为人们日常生活和工作中不可或缺的一部分。为了满足不同行业、不同规模企业和个人用户的需求,市场上涌现出了众多专门APP软件开发定制软件。这些软件以其强大的功能、灵活的定制选项和专业的技术支持,为开发者提供了丰富的选择。接下来将介绍一些常见的专门APP软件开发定制软件。

随着科技的不断发展,移动应用已成为人们日常生活和工作中不可或缺的一部分。为了满足不同行业、不同规模企业和个人用户的需求,市场上涌现出了众多专门APP软件开发定制软件。这些软件以其强大的功能、灵活的定制选项和专业的技术支持,为开发者提供了丰富的选择。接下来将介绍一些常见的专门APP软件开发定制软件:

一、AppGenius

1. 界面设计:AppGenius提供了一个直观的用户界面,使开发者能够轻松地创建和编辑应用程序。它提供了多种主题和布局选项,帮助开发者快速构建出吸引人的应用程序界面。

2. 功能扩展:AppGenius支持多种编程语言,如Objective-C、Swift等,使得开发者可以根据自身需求选择合适的语言进行开发。同时,它还提供了丰富的API和插件,帮助开发者实现各种功能。

3. 性能优化:AppGenius注重应用程序的性能优化,提供了多种工具和方法来提高应用程序的运行速度和稳定性。它还提供了实时监控和分析功能,帮助开发者及时发现并解决应用程序中的问题。

二、Xcode

1. 跨平台开发:Xcode是苹果公司官方开发的集成开发环境,支持跨平台开发。这意味着开发者可以使用Xcode在iOS、macOS、watchOS和tvOS等多个平台上开发应用程序。这使得开发者能够更灵活地选择开发平台,满足不同场景下的需求。

2. 代码管理:Xcode提供了强大的代码管理和版本控制功能,帮助开发者更好地组织和管理代码。它还支持多种版本控制系统,如Git、SVN等,方便开发者进行版本控制和协作。

3. 调试与测试:Xcode提供了强大的调试和测试功能,帮助开发者快速定位和解决问题。它还支持多种测试框架和工具,如UI自动化、性能测试等,帮助开发者全面测试应用程序的功能和性能。

三、Android Studio

1. 多平台支持:Android Studio是谷歌官方开发的集成开发环境,支持Android、Java、Kotlin等多种编程语言。这使得开发者可以在同一环境中开发多个平台的应用,提高了开发效率。

2. 组件化开发:Android Studio提供了强大的组件化开发支持,帮助开发者快速构建复杂的应用程序。它还支持模块化和插件化开发,使得开发者可以根据需要添加或删除组件,提高应用程序的可扩展性和可维护性。

3. 性能优化:Android Studio注重应用程序的性能优化,提供了多种工具和方法来提高应用程序的运行速度和稳定性。它还提供了实时监控和分析功能,帮助开发者及时发现并解决应用程序中的问题。

四、PhoneGap

1. 跨平台开发:PhoneGap是一个开源的跨平台框架,允许开发者使用HTML5、CSS3和JavaScript等技术在多个平台上开发原生应用程序。这使得开发者能够利用现有的Web技术快速构建跨平台的应用程序。

专门APP软件开发定制软件有哪些

2. 资源丰富:PhoneGap提供了丰富的第三方库和插件,帮助开发者实现各种功能。这些资源涵盖了社交、通讯、地图、支付等多个领域,使得开发者能够根据需求选择合适的资源进行开发。

3. 社区支持:PhoneGap拥有庞大的开发者社区,提供了大量的教程、文档和示例代码。这使得开发者能够更容易地学习和掌握PhoneGap的开发技巧,同时也能够获得来自社区的支持和帮助。

五、Flutter

1. 高性能渲染:Flutter是一个由Google开发的移动应用开发框架,采用声明式编程方式,使得开发过程更加简洁高效。Flutter通过其高效的渲染机制,实现了高性能的动画和视觉效果,为用户提供流畅的用户体验。

2. 跨平台支持:Flutter不仅支持Android和iOS平台,还支持Web和桌面端。这使得开发者能够在一个统一的开发环境中完成多平台的应用开发,提高了开发效率和降低了开发成本。

3. 丰富的插件生态:Flutter提供了丰富的插件生态,包括相机、位置、网络等常用功能。这些插件可以帮助开发者快速实现各种功能,提高应用的可用性和吸引力。

六、React Native

1. 轻量级框架:React Native是一个用于构建原生应用的JavaScript框架,它允许开发者使用JavaScript编写代码,并通过JSX语法将代码转换为原生代码。这使得React Native成为了许多开发者的首选框架,因为它提供了一种简单的方式来构建原生应用。

2. 组件化开发:React Native支持组件化开发,使得开发者能够将应用划分为独立的组件,并进行复用和维护。这种模块化的架构使得应用更加灵活和可维护,也便于团队协作和版本控制。

3. 性能优化:React Native注重应用的性能优化,提供了多种工具和方法来提高应用的运行速度和稳定性。例如,它支持虚拟滚动、内存管理等技术,帮助开发者优化应用的性能表现。

七、Electron

1. 桌面应用开发:Electron是一个基于浏览器的跨平台框架,允许开发者使用HTML、CSS和JavaScript等技术在Windows、macOS和Linux等操作系统上开发桌面应用。这使得Electron成为了许多开发者在开发跨平台桌面应用时的首选框架。

2. 多进程架构:Electron采用了多进程架构,使得每个应用都有自己的进程空间,互不干扰。这种架构使得Electron应用具有更好的性能和稳定性,同时也便于进行多任务处理和资源隔离。

3. 丰富的插件生态:Electron提供了丰富的插件生态,包括文件管理器、剪贴板、系统通知等常用功能。这些插件可以帮助开发者快速实现各种功能,提高应用的可用性和吸引力。

综上所述,这些专门APP软件开发定制软件各有特点和优势,为开发者提供了丰富的选择。在选择适合自己需求的软件时,开发者应根据自己的项目需求、团队技能和预算等因素进行综合考虑。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-2229741.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

0条点评 4.5星

办公自动化

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

简道云 简道云

0条点评 4.5星

低代码开发平台

纷享销客CRM 纷享销客CRM

0条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

109条点评 4.5星

客户管理系统

金蝶云星空 金蝶云星空

117条点评 4.4星

ERP管理系统

钉钉 钉钉

108条点评 4.6星

办公自动化

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

唯智TMS 唯智TMS

0条点评 4.6星

物流配送系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部